OpenClaw 技术专题 (六):实践之路 (The Roadmap)

5 阅读3分钟

引言:通往“主权 AI”的最后一步

理论的终点是实践。在前面的章节中,我们剖析了 OpenClaw 的思维、记忆、行动和感官。本章将通过一个典型的“程序员 Agent”实战场景,带你走通从零构建一个高效数字员工的全过程,并展望 Agent 技术的未来。


1. 实战:构建一个“自进化 Web 发现助手”

单个工具的调用只是“脚本”,而通过 OpenClaw 组合多种能力才叫“员工”。

1.1 核心配置:Skill 与 MCP 的合力

我们为 Agent 配置了一个专门用于深度研究的技能包 research-specialist

SKILL.md (技能约束)

# Research Specialist Skill
- 职责:通过 Web 搜索获取最新技术趋势,并生成对比报告。
- 依赖:`web_search` MCP tool, `file_write` tool.
- 容错:若搜索超时,需尝试更换关键词并在 5 秒后重试。

MCP 配置 (Tool Discovery)

// mcp-servers.json
{
  "brave-search": {
    "command": "npx",
    "args": ["-y", "@modelcontextprotocol/server-brave-search"],
    "env": { "BRAVE_API_KEY": "REDACTED" }
  }
}

1.2 运行实录:见证“韧性”

当用户在 Discord 输入:“帮我对比当前主流 Agent 框架的可观测性方案”时,后台发生了以下链条:

  1. 感知:Discord 插件捕获输入,路由至 activeSession
  2. 思考:Agent 调用 memory_search 确认本地无缓存,决定使用 brave_search
  3. 行动与容错:由于网络波动,第一次 API 调用超时。此时 pi-embedded-runner 捕获异常,Agent 根据 SKILL.md 的重试策略,自动精简查询词并成功获取结果。
  4. 渐进式披露:Agent 仅加载了处理搜索结果所需的 3 个关键工具,而非全量加载 50 个工具,保持了极高的推理精度和低 Token 延迟。

1.3 核心价值:从“黑盒”到“数字白领”

通过这个案例,我们可以看到 OpenClaw 的实战威力:

  • 可观测性:架构师在 Langfuse 仪表盘上清晰看到了那次“超时重试”的完整 Trace。
  • 并发安全:即便同时有 5 个用户发起搜索,Redis (或本地 .jsonl 锁) 确保了每个 Agent 研究员都在独立的沙箱中运行,互不干扰。
  • 渐进披露:通过延迟加载 Skill 详情,10k+ 字的搜索结果在不超出上下文窗口的前提下被精准总结。

3. 未来展望:自进化 Agent 的形态

OpenClaw 的路线图指向了两个极具吸引力的方向:

A. 自进化 (Self-Evolution)

未来的 Agent 不仅会执行任务,还会“自我修补”。当它发现现有的 MCP 工具无法解决问题时,它会尝试编写一个新的临时插件并部署到沙箱中执行。OpenClaw 的架构为此预留了动态加载机制。

B. 分布式 OpenClaw 网关

在大型企业中,Agent 不会运行在单机上。分布式的 OpenClaw 网关将实现横向扩展:

  • 大脑共享:不同节点间的 ContextEngine 可以通过共享向量库实现知识同步。
  • 行动协同:一个位于北京的网关可以调度位于硅谷的 MCP Server 执行任务。

结语

“数字员工”不是未来,它是正在发生的现在。OpenClaw 作为这股浪潮中的底层基础设施,正在通过其严谨的工程化设计,将 LLM 的无限潜力引导入真实的生产轨道。

希望本系列专题文章,能成为你构建自进化 Agent 团队的路线图。探索愉快!